## Service Accounts

The `hc-probe` service account is used exclusively by the Bramblewick load balancer to call each backend's `/health/deep` endpoint. Reviewers should verify that no pull request broadens this account's scope beyond read-only health queries, as it is deliberately minimal. The account authenticates to the internal Bramblewick control API with a static credential, rotated quarterly. For local verification of probe behavior, use the key below.

gateway credential: kto23_LX9A4ys6i4nzHtpOLNLodKK

## Formula sandbox tuning

User-supplied formulas in Gridmoor execute inside a restricted interpreter with hard ceilings on time, memory, and call depth. Reviewers should confirm any change to these ceilings is justified in the PR description, since raising them widens the abuse surface. Defaults were chosen from production traces. The current limits are as follows.

limits module of tafog-fawip:
WEIGHTS = {
    "julix": 57,
    "lamys": 992,
    "kasvan": 209,
    "quenok": 750,
    "alddor": 259,
    "oliath": 1009,
    "wenix": 815,
}

☐ Key ceremony step 7 — Eventspine schema registry. Two custodians present; witness from security signs off. Generate new registry signing keypair on the air-gapped box at Marlowe Annex. Verify fingerprint read-aloud matches printed copy. Seal private share in envelope B. Before sealing, confirm the escrow vault accepts the unseal material. The recovery passphrase to record on the ceremony sheet is:

vault phrase of kawep-tahog = ulaix-briath

# Break-Glass: SwiftPin Autocomplete Admin

If the SwiftPin address autocomplete widget starts returning garbage suggestions and the on-call owner is unreachable, support can use break-glass access to disable it tenant-wide. Heads up: this pages the Northquay platform team automatically, so only do it for real outages. Log your reason in the incident channel first. The break-glass console unlocks with the passphrase below.

unlock words, yawig-kagef: gordor-holvan-ulaael-pramir-ulaiel-tamdor